What is a Remote Inventory Control job?

A Remote Inventory Control job involves managing and tracking a company's inventory from a remote location, often using specialized software. Professionals in this role ensure that stock levels are accurate, monitor shipments, and coordinate with warehouses or vendors to maintain proper inventory records. They may also analyze inventory trends, generate reports, and help optimize inventory processes to minimize costs and maximize efficiency. Communication and organizational skills, as well as proficiency with inventory management systems, are important for success in this job.

What are the 4 types of inventory control?

The four main types of inventory control are perpetual, periodic, ABC analysis, and just-in-time (JIT). Perpetual and periodic systems track inventory levels continuously or at regular intervals, while ABC analysis categorizes inventory based on value or importance. JIT minimizes inventory by receiving goods only as needed, which requires precise coordination and inventory management skills.

What are some common challenges faced in a remote inventory control role, and how can they be addressed?

A common challenge in remote inventory control is maintaining real-time accuracy and visibility into stock levels without being physically present at the warehouse. This can be addressed by leveraging inventory management software that supports real-time data entry and regular communication with on-site staff. Establishing clear protocols for reporting discrepancies and scheduling frequent virtual check-ins with the warehouse team also helps ensure issues are resolved promptly. Staying organized and proactive in monitoring inventory reports is key to overcoming these challenges.
